Garfield Mutual Domestic Water Consumers & Mutual Sewage Works is located in Garfield, NM. The organization was established in 1981. According to its NTEE Classification (W80) the organization is classified as: Public Utilities, under the broad grouping of Public & Societal Benefit and related organizations. As of 06/2024, Garfield Mutual Domestic Water Consumers & Mutual Sewage Works employed 4 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Garfield Mutual Domestic Water Consumers & Mutual Sewage Works is a 501(c)(12) and as such, is described as a "Benevolent Life Insurance Association, Mutual Ditch or Irrigation Company, Mutual or Cooperative Telephone Company"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2024, Garfield Mutual Domestic Water Consumers & Mutual Sewage Works generated $1.6m in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 9 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 7.9%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$785.1k during the year ending 06/2024. While expenses have increased by 7.5% per year over the past 9 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
PROTECTING THE HEALTH AND WELFARE OF THE MEMBERS OF THE ASSOCIATION BY PROVIDING SAFE DRINKING WATER.
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
TO PROVIDE CLEAN DRINKING WATER TO THE CITIZENS OF THE ASSOCIATION BY A LOCAL GOVERNMENT MUTUAL DOMESTIC WATER CONSUMER ASSOCIATION REGULATED AS A LOCAL GOVERNMENT UNDER THE STATUTES OF THE STATE OF NEW MEXICO.
